To His Majesty's Justices of the Peace for the County of Middx
in their General Session of the Peace held for the said County in the
month of September 1781 assembled

The Humble Petition of Samual Newport< no role >
Keeper of New Prison at Clerkenwell in the
County of Middlesex

Sheweth


That at the General Session of the Peace held for this
County in the month of December last your Petitioner presented as
Petition selling forth various hardships loses and Expences which he
then had suffered and incurred in consequence of the number of prisoner's
in his Custody since the then late dreadful Riots that your Worships were
then so indulgent as to grant your Petitioner Twenty Pounds and to
intimate to your Petitioner that if he continued to labour under such
circumstances for any longer time your Worships would be pleased to
make him some further allowance That your Petitioner hath continued
to labour under circumstances of the like kind from that time to the
present is within the knowledge of many of Your Worships but should
it be doubted your Petitioner is ready to inform your Worships of the
particulars of his situation in respect to the extraordinary trouble anxoity
and Expence he has suffered and even at present suffers in the management
and Government of the very great number of annuity and desperate
offenders which have been in the time last abovementioned and now
are in his Custody

Your Petitioner therefore most humbly and
earnestly prays that your worships will be
pleased to take his case into Consideration and
grant to him such other recompense as to your
Worships shall seem meet

And Your Petitioner as in duty bound will
ever pray Etc.

Samuel Newport< no role >
